Stock Photo - 14 July 2022, Mecklenburg-Western Pomerania, Rostock: Annalena Baerbock (Bündnis 90/Die Grünen), Foreign Minister, stands behind a glider bomb from World War II during her visit to the Fraunhofer Institute for Computer Graphics Research at the start of her ten-day tour of Germany and follows the explanations of Eyk-Uwe Pop (r), Managing Director of Baltic Taucherei- und Bergungsbetrieb. During her tour, the Green politician wants to gather information and impressions for a National Security Strategy. The institute conducts research on the ecological effects of munitions waste and the detection of munitions in the sea. Photo: Jens Büttner/dpa. - Rostock/Mecklenburg-Western Pomerania/Germany
